Amachree still Rivers House speaker, says group

Speaker Otelemaba Amachree

Okafor ofiebor/Port Harcourt

The 26 pro-Governor Chibuike Amaechi members of the Rivers State House of Assembly today debunked reports of the impeachment of the Speaker, Otelemaba Daniel Amachree by five renegade members of the Assembly.

A statement signed by Dan Amachree and the other 25 lawmakers said: “We state for the benefit of the public that no such situation existed on the floor of the House on the 9th of July, 2013. These are mere machinations of the five members desperate to do their masters bidding”.

They stated that the claim by a member of the Assembly, Evans Bapakaye Bipi to be the new speaker is “false and hallucinations of the most debased form. We urge members of the public and the press to disregard such claims.”

The lawmakers declared their whole-hearted support for Speaker Otelemaba Dan Amachree and Governor Amaechi.

They condemned those they called agents of the “desperate Abuja based politicians”. whose mission, they said was “to scuttle democracy in Rivers State”.

“We call on the Inspector-General Police to ensure the safety of lives and property in Rivers State.”

The Lawmakers however urged Rivers people to remain calm and peaceful.

The Pro Amaechi lawmakers used to be 27 but in the statement only 26 of them signed the statement.

Mr. Jim Odede Okpiki, the Press Secretary to the Speaker explained that the signatures were obtained from those who were physically present in the country.

He said the Tonye Harry, the immediate past Speaker representing Degema Constituency is out of the country, but assured that he is with Amaechi.

Meanwhile,the factional chairman of the Peoples Democratic Party,PDP,Mr Felix Obuah,has condemned the takeover of Rivers House of Assembly by the House of Representatives.

Obuah who is loyal to Nyesom Wike and President Goodluck Jonathan accused Governor Chibuike Amaechi of hiring party thugs to disrupt proceedings at the assembly and also supervised the beating up of the five lawmakers opposed to him.

He said that as a party,it recognises Evans Bipi as the new Speaker of the Rivers Assembly and congratulated him for his emergence.

Amaechi on his part,condemned the role of the Police in the chaos at the Assembly because of the refusal to provide security for the lawmakers even after a proper request was made to the Rivers State Command.

The Governor said this when the Pro-Amaechi lawmakers paid him a solidarity visit in Government House.

He pledged that the state Government will pick up the hospital bills of all the lawmakers and individuals who sustained injuries in the crisis.
